There is a dedicated page on NIST website to submit new modes:

https://csrc.nist.gov/projects/block-cipher-techniques/bcm/modes-develoment

If your mode is applicable to AES and is significantly better than « approved » modes, your submission is likely to be taken into account but be patient, NIST does not move fast for such things and there are two competitions going on.

To be successful you will need security analysis, preferably by a third party academic.
